Research Manuscript Tracking Tools

Research manuscript tracking tools are specialized software platforms designed to streamline the process of submitting, reviewing, and managing academic papers and research manuscripts. They facilitate communication between authors, editors, and reviewers, ensuring efficient handling of submissions throughout the publication pipeline. These tools help reduce administrative burdens, improve transparency, and enhance the overall peer review process.

Key Features

  • Submission management and assignment
  • Automated workflow tracking
  • Integration with journal management systems
  • Reviewer invitation and response tracking
  • Communication portals for authors, editors, and reviewers
  • Status notifications and progress updates
  • Reporting and analytics capabilities

Pros

  • Significantly improves efficiency in manuscript handling
  • Enhances communication among stakeholders
  • Reduces manual administrative tasks
  • Provides clear visibility into review status
  • Supports multiple users simultaneously

Cons

  • Can be costly for small or new journals
  • Steep learning curve for some platforms
  • Dependence on consistent user engagement and compliance
  • Limited customization options for some tools
